Each quarter, the National Renewable Energy Laboratory conducts the Quarterly Solar Industry Update, a presentation of technical trends within the solar industry. Each presentation focuses on global and U. supply and demand, module and system price, investment trends and business models, and. . China has invested over USD 50 billion in new PV supply capacity – ten times more than Europe − and created more than 300 000 manufacturing jobs across the solar PV value chain since 2011. Photovoltaic panel base construction plan
Key considerations for solar installations include foundation depth (typically 1/6 of pole height plus 2 feet), concrete strength, reinforcement design, and soil bearing capacity. Proper foundation engineering is crucial for long-term stability of solar lighting systems. Solar panel installation costs range from $15,000 to $30,000 for an average American home, with a payback period of 6 to 10 years depending on your state's incentives and sun exposure. Timeline Reality: The complete solar installation process typically takes 60-120 days from consultation to activation, with permitting being the longest phase (30-45 days) rather than the actual installation (1-3 days). 2025 Financial Landscape: While the federal ITC remains at 30% through 2032. .

How many photovoltaic power plants should be installed?
To provide sufficient supply for the global energy consumption, a cumulative amount of 18 TW of photovoltaic power plants should be installed. This means the solar energy industry has a long way to reach to a point where at least 10% of the world energy consumption is generated by solar plants.
Can distributed solar power plants be integrated into urban buildings?
In the technology of distributed solar power plants, scholars are constantly exploring the integration of solar modules into building materials or structures, and efficient integration of new energy power generation technologies with urban buildings. This technology is already photovoltaic building integration.
